netapp.ontap.na_ontap_rest_info – NetApp ONTAP information gatherer using REST APIs
Note
This plugin is part of the netapp.ontap collection (version 21.12.0).
You might already have this collection installed if you are using the ansible package. It is not included in ansible-core. To check whether it is installed, run ansible-galaxy collection list.
To install it, use: ansible-galaxy collection install netapp.ontap.
To use it in a playbook, specify: netapp.ontap.na_ontap_rest_info.
New in version 20.5.0: of netapp.ontap
Synopsis
- This module allows you to gather various information about ONTAP configuration using REST APIs
 
Requirements
The below requirements are needed on the host that executes this module.
- Ansible 2.9
 - Python3 netapp-lib (2018.11.13) or later. Install using ‘pip install netapp-lib’
 - netapp-lib 2020.3.12 is strongly recommended as it provides better error reporting for connection issues.
 - A physical or virtual clustered Data ONTAP system. The modules support Data ONTAP 9.1 and onward.
 - REST support requires ONTAP 9.6 or later.
 - To enable http on the cluster you must run the following commands ‘set -privilege advanced;’ ‘system services web modify -http-enabled true;’

        REST API if supported by the target system for all the resources and attributes the module requires. Otherwise will revert to ZAPI.
        
       
        always -- will always use the REST API
        
       
        never -- will always use the ZAPI
        
       
        auto -- will try to use the REST Api

| username
        
        string
         | 
      
        
        This can be a Cluster-scoped or SVM-scoped account, depending on whether a Cluster-level or SVM-level API is required.
        
       
        For more information, please read the documentation https://mysupport.netapp.com/NOW/download/software/nmsdk/9.4/.
        
       
        Two authentication methods are supported
        
       
        1. basic authentication, using username and password,
        
       
        2. SSL certificate authentication, using a ssl client cert file, and optionally a private key file.
        
       
        To use a certificate, the certificate must have been installed in the ONTAP cluster, and cert authentication must have been enabled.

Examples
- name: run ONTAP gather facts for vserver info
  netapp.ontap.na_ontap_rest_info:
      hostname: "1.2.3.4"
      username: "testuser"
      password: "test-password"
      https: true
      validate_certs: false
      use_rest: Always
      gather_subset:
      - vserver_info
- name: run ONTAP gather facts for aggregate info and volume info
  netapp.ontap.na_ontap_rest_info:
      hostname: "1.2.3.4"
      username: "testuser"
      password: "test-password"
      https: true
      validate_certs: false
      use_rest: Always
      gather_subset:
      - aggregate_info
      - volume_info
- name: run ONTAP gather facts for all subsets
  netapp.ontap.na_ontap_rest_info:
      hostname: "1.2.3.4"
      username: "testuser"
      password: "test-password"
      https: true
      validate_certs: false
      use_rest: Always
      gather_subset:
      - all
- name: run ONTAP gather facts for aggregate info and volume info with fields section
  netapp.ontap.na_ontap_rest_info:
      hostname: "1.2.3.4"
      username: "testuser"
      password: "test-password"
      https: true
      fields:
        - '*'
      validate_certs: false
      use_rest: Always
      gather_subset:
        - aggregate_info
        - volume_info
- name: run ONTAP gather facts for aggregate info with specified fields
  netapp.ontap.na_ontap_rest_info:
      hostname: "1.2.3.4"
      username: "testuser"
      password: "test-password"
      https: true
      fields:
        - 'uuid'
        - 'name'
        - 'node'
      validate_certs: false
      use_rest: Always
      gather_subset:
        - aggregate_info
      parameters:
        recommend:
          true
- name: run ONTAP gather facts for volume info with query on name and state
  netapp.ontap.na_ontap_rest_info:
      hostname: "1.2.3.4"
      username: "testuser"
      password: "test-password"
      https: true
      validate_certs: false
      gather_subset:
        - volume_info
      parameters:
        name: ansible*
        state: online
